Web20 sep. 2024 · We can use the distance the meter stick fell before you caught it to figure out your reaction time. The following formula is the basis: d = 1/2 gt2. WebA reaction - simple reaction. - single stimulus occurs and observer responds by quickly pressing a key or button. - baseline of cognitive operations for more complicated responses. - example - alarm clock goes off - pushing button to turn it off. B reaction - choice reaction time. - more than 1 stimulus and more than 1 response.
